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

An operating device for a height-adjustable seatpost tube including a lifting magnet. The lifting magnet has a magnetic core surrounded by a coil. The magnetic core cooperates with an actuating device of a lifting device, the lifting device being a pneumatic lifting device for height-adjustment of the seatpost tube and thus for heigh-adjustment of the seat, for example.

First claim

Opening claim text (preview).

The invention claimed is: 1. An operating device for a height-adjustable seatpost tube comprising: an outer seatpost tube; an inner seatpost tube, such that the inner seatpost tube is at least partially located within the outer seatpost tube; a lifting magnet located in a housing, the lifting magnet having a coil surrounding a magnetic core such that the housing is disposed at and operatively connected to a bottom end of the outer seatpost tube; an electrical switching device connected to the coil; an actuating device cooperating with the magnetic core for actuation of a lifting device of the height-adjustable seatpost tube; a preloading device having a first end and a second end, the first end acting on a front side of the magnetic core; and an adjustment device located at the second end of the preloading device, wherein the lifting device is selected from a pneumatic device, a hydraulic device, and/or a spring device, and wherein the inner seatpost tube can be adjusted by a user by actuation of the lifting device. 2. The operating device according to claim 1 , wherein the actuating device is connected with the front side of the magnetic core. 3. The operating device according to claim 2 , wherein the front side of the magnetic core cooperating with the actuating device is opposite a rear side cooperating with the preloading device. 4. The operating device according to claim 2 , wherein the actuating device rests on the magnetic core. 5. The operating device according to claim 1 , wherein the actuating device is bar-shaped. 6. The operating device according to claim 5 , wherein the actuating device extends in a longitudinal direction of the magnetic core. 7. The operating device according to claim 1 , wherein a stop for the magnetic core connects in a stopped position in an actuating position. 8. The operating device according to claim 1 , wherein the lifting magnet is disposed at least partially inside the housing. 9. The operating device according to claim 8 , wherein a stop is connected to the housing. 10. The operating device according to claim 9 , wherein the stop is integrally formed with the housing. 11. The operating device according to claim 1 , wherein the preloading device is a preloading spring. 12. The operating device according to claim 11 , wherein the preloading device rests on the magnetic core. 13. The operating device according to claim 11 , wherein the preloading device is connected to an adjusting device for adjusting a preloading force. 14. The operating device according to claim 1 , wherein a force required to operate the lifting device is applied partially by the preloading device and partially by the lifting magnet.
